My sub to FindMyPast falls due in the middle of January. I've had one of the legacy Britain subscriptions.

Just a heads up - with only 10 days to go, I've just had an email to say that the Britain subscription is being withdrawn, and I am being moved onto a Pro subscription. They are, however, offering it to me with (this year!) a 25% discount, and after this year it will revert to the normal 15% loyalty discount. That, of course, is if I stay!

Presumably that will now apply to all of us on these legacy subscriptions!

That, of course, leaves me free to rethink whether I bother with FindMyPast, or shift to having a British Newspaper Archive sub instead!

« Reply #6 on: Monday 04 January 21 18:21 GMT (UK) »
Yes, very disappointing. They snuck my updated reminder in under cover of the deluge of emails just pre-Xmas.
The 25% initial discount still means it comes to more than the full price of the sub I was on before, and is a full18% higher than the loyalty discounted price I had paid last year.
Assuming no further rises, then next year the discount will reduce back to the standard 15% loyalty, meaning I'll be expected to pay 33% more than I paid previously (both would be at the 15% discounted rate).
And what do I get for this? Nothing new that is relevant to me that I wasn't getting already. And if I don't want to pay the extra, can I "trade down"? No, I have to cancel my existing sub and take out a new one at the lower level and be treated like a brand new customer (meaning I would lose the 15% loyalty discount)
